Major gas works are set to cause two weeks of misery for motorists and bus passengers, with closures on a Netherfield town centre route.
Contractors Network Plus will work on behalf of Cadent Gas to carry out gas replacement works that will require the closure of Victoria Road.
The works are scheduled to take place between Monday, October 23 and Sunday, November 5th.

Works were scheduled to take place back in September but plans were abandoned.
During the latest works, 44 and 44A buses will be diverted and not serve the town they will divert via Burton Road, Colwick Loop Road and Private Road No. 1 in both directions.
A spokesman for NCT said: “Stops sited on Manor Road, Station Road, Victoria Road, Meadow Road and Chaworth Road cannot be served.”
